The Global Certificate in Evidence-Based Facility Adaptation course is a comprehensive program designed to equip learners with essential skills in climate change adaptation for facilities worldwide. This course highlights the importance of using data-driven, evidence-based methods to enhance the resilience of buildings and infrastructure in the face of climate change.

The Global Certificate in Evidence-Based Facility Adaptation is a valuable credential for professionals working in the UK's ever-evolving built environment sector. This section features a 3D pie chart that showcases the job market trends, skill demand, and salary ranges for various roles related to facility adaptation. 1. **Facility Manager**: As a facility manager, you will be responsible for ensuring that buildings and other facilities operate efficiently while minimizing their environmental impact. The average salary for this role in the UK is around £40,000 per year, and job market trends are expected to grow by 5% in the next five years. 2. **Sustainability Consultant**: Sustainability consultants help businesses and organizations reduce their carbon footprint and improve their environmental performance. These professionals earn an average salary of £38,000 per year in the UK, and job market growth is projected at 7% in the coming years. 3. **Climate Change Analyst**: Climate change analysts gather and interpret data on greenhouse gas emissions, temperature trends, and other climate-related factors. The average salary for this role in the UK is approximately £35,000 per year, and the job market is expected to grow by 10% in the next five years. 4. **Built Environment Specialist**: Built environment specialists work on the planning, design, and construction of infrastructure projects with a focus on sustainability and resilience. These professionals earn around £33,000 per year in the UK, and job market trends are forecasted to grow by 6% in the near future. 5. **Disaster Risk Reduction Expert**: Disaster risk reduction experts help organizations plan for and respond to natural disasters and other emergencies. The average salary for this role in the UK is about £30,000 per year, and job market growth is projected at 8% in the next five years.
